Monthly Traffic Safety Analysis
5,369 CRASHES IN
IOWA, IA
OCTOBER 2018
In October 2018, there were 5,369 traffic crashes, a negligible 0.04% decrease from the 5,371 crashes recorded in October 2017. While the total number of incidents remained stable, the most notable year-over-year shift was a significant 29.4% reduction in traffic fatalities, which fell from 34 to 24.

When Crashes Happen
The timing of crashes shifted between the two periods. In October 2018, the peak day for crashes was Wednesday with 933 incidents, a change from Tuesday (872 incidents) in the prior year. The peak hour also shifted from the afternoon to the morning, moving from 3 p.m. in 2017 (428 crashes) to 7 a.m. in 2018 (441 crashes).

Crash Severity Breakdown
Crash severity saw a notable improvement year-over-year. The fatal crash rate decreased from 0.54% of all crashes in October 2017 to 0.43% in October 2018. The number of fatal crashes fell from 29 to 23, and serious injury crashes also declined from 103 to 86. Conversely, crashes resulting in minor injuries increased from 422 to 460.
Severity is per crash event (most severe injury). 23 fatal crash events resulted in 24 persons killed.

Top Contributing Factors
Collisions involving animals remained the top contributing factor in both periods, increasing in count by 8.0% from 1,072 to 1,158 incidents. 'Followed too close' was the second most common factor in both years, with a slight increase from 586 to 606 crashes. A significant decrease was observed in crashes attributed to 'Lost Control,' which fell by 26.2% from 290 incidents in 2017 to 214 in 2018, dropping its rank from the 5th to the 7th most common factor.

Vehicles & Demographics
The top vehicle makes involved in crashes remained consistent, with Ford and Chevrolet leading in both October 2017 and October 2018. An analysis of persons involved shows a shift in age demographics. The number of individuals in the 26-34 age group involved in crashes increased from 1,377 to 1,530, and the 35-44 age group increased from 1,291 to 1,338. Conversely, involvement decreased for younger drivers, with the 16-20 age group falling from 1,290 to 1,249 and the 21-25 group falling from 1,065 to 993.

Analytical Methodology
- Severity classification: Uses the KABCO injury scale (K=Fatal, A=Incapacitating injury, B=Non-incapacitating injury, C=Possible injury, O=No injury/property damage only), the standard classification in U.S. Model Minimum Uniform Crash Criteria (MMUCC). Severity is assigned per crash event based on the most severe injury in that crash. A single fatal crash (K) may involve multiple fatalities; therefore the "Persons Killed" count in the headline KPIs may differ from the "Fatal" crash count in the severity breakdown.
